Why Is Woodcutting a Favored Skilling Method Among Early Players in OSRS?

Woodcutting is a favored skilling method among early players in Old School RuneScape (OSRS) for several reasons. The activity is accessible, straightforward, and provides a steady source of experience points and resources.

Woodcutting is defined as the skill that allows players to chop down trees to obtain logs. These logs serve various purposes, including crafting, fire-making, and construction in the game. According to the Jagex Wiki, the official source of information for OSRS, woodcutting is one of the first skills players typically pursue due to its fundamental importance in crafting and resource gathering.

The popularity of woodcutting among early players can be attributed to several underlying factors:
– Accessibility: Players can start woodcutting almost immediately after beginning the game. There are numerous trees available in the starting areas, which makes the skill easy to initiate.
– Low Requirements: Woodcutting has minimal level requirements for its initial trees. Players can chop down normal trees without any prerequisite skills.
– Immediate Rewards: Each tree chopped gives instant experience points (XP) and resources, directly contributing to the player’s progress in the game.

Key terms associated with woodcutting include:
– Logs: The primary resource obtained through woodcutting, used in various crafting and construction activities.
– Experience Points (XP): A measure of progress in skills, which increments as players perform specific actions like chopping trees.

The mechanics of woodcutting involve the player targeting a tree and using their axe to chop it down. The player must first equip a suitable axe, which is graded by efficiency. Different axes, such as bronze, iron, or rune, allow players to chop logs faster. When a tree is felled, it drops logs that players can collect.

Specific conditions that contribute to the popularity of woodcutting include:
– Proximity of Trees: The abundance of trees in starting locations ensures players can easily gather resources without traveling far.
– Community Engagement: Woodcutting often occurs in areas where other players are present, fostering a sense of community.
– Profitability: As players progress, they can sell logs in the game’s marketplace, generating in-game currency, which motivates them to continue woodcutting.

Overall, woodcutting’s accessibility, low entry requirements, immediate rewards, and community aspects make it a favored choice for early players in OSRS.

What Inventory Management Techniques Can Maximize Profits from Manual Money Makers in OSRS?

Inventory management techniques can effectively maximize profits from manual money makers in Old School RuneScape (OSRS).

  1. Price Monitoring
  2. Stock Optimization
  3. Diversification of Items
  4. Efficient Use of Bank Space
  5. Timely Selling

Transitioning from these techniques, different strategies may yield varying results depending on player preferences or market fluctuations.

1. Price Monitoring:
Price monitoring involves regularly checking the Grand Exchange for changes in item prices. Staying updated with market trends allows the player to buy low and sell high. Players can utilize websites like OSRSPrice or Discord channels for real-time price data. For example, a player who tracked the price of raw materials could buy them at a lower rate and sell items crafted from these materials at inflated prices following demand spikes.

2. Stock Optimization:
Stock optimization refers to managing inventory in a way that maximizes profit. It includes knowing the ideal quantity to hold of each item. Players should avoid overstocking common items that may reduce their value over time, while ensuring they have enough of rare items that can provide greater returns. An example is a player keeping a limited supply of rare items like Party Hats, which historically maintain high value.

3. Diversification of Items:
Diversification involves trading multiple types of items to spread risk and maximize profit potential. Players should focus on both common and rare items. For instance, crafting items such as potions can provide regular income while holding onto rare items can yield larger profits when sold strategically. This technique minimizes the risk of loss when market prices for specific items drop.

4. Efficient Use of Bank Space:
Efficient use of bank space allows players to maximize the number of items they can trade. Players should organize their banks by item type and importance, ensuring high-value items are easily accessible. For instance, consolidating stackable items frees up space for rare non-stackable items. This method ensures that players have quick access to items that can be sold immediately when market conditions are favorable.

5. Timely Selling:
Timely selling emphasizes the importance of selling items at peak demand times. Players should track in-game events, updates, or holidays that may influence item value. For example, a player selling Christmas-themed items shortly after the holiday can capture heightened demand, increasing profits. Failing to sell items when they are in high demand may result in lower sale prices later.

These inventory management techniques provide structured approaches for players to enhance their profitability in OSRS while engaging with the game’s economy.
